Dollar General Expands One-Dollar Product Line for Holiday Season

Dollar General is significantly increasing its inventory of one-dollar items heading into the holidays, adopting a pricing strategy traditionally used by major grocery chains. The move aims to draw cost-sensitive consumers and boost foot traffic during a critical retail period.

Dollar Tree and Dollar General Report Strong Q2 Earnings Amid Consumer Trade-Down
BusinessNYTwsjYahoo+3seeking-alphainvesting-comzerohedge3d ago6 sources

Dollar Tree and Dollar General Report Strong Q2 Earnings Amid Consumer Trade-Down

Dollar Tree and Dollar General both reported stronger-than-expected second-quarter earnings driven by increased foot traffic from cost-conscious shoppers. Both retailers raised their full-year guidance, though management cautioned that tariff-related expenses will impact near-term margins.
